What does SI-11 Tian Zong do?
Tian Zong SI-11 is the principal point of the shoulder blade — the Small Intestine channel's point in the hollow of the scapula, whose recorded work is to open the channel and relieve scapular pain, to move qi and unbind the chest and the flanks, and to benefit the breasts. Sacred Lotus sources & references record those three actions directly, and all three follow from where the point sits: on the back of the shoulder blade, level with the fourth thoracic vertebra, over the thick muscle that fills the hollow below the ridge of the scapula.
- Activates the channel and alleviates pain — the first recorded action and the busiest one in modern practice. The Small Intestine channel crosses the scapula on its way from the little finger to the ear, and SI-11 is the point at which it crosses the widest part. It is used for pain and stiffness of the shoulder blade, for pain that will not let the arm lift, and for pain referred down the back and outer side of the arm to the elbow.
- Moves qi and unbinds the chest and the lateral costal region — the second recorded action, and the one that takes this point beyond the shoulder. "Unbinding the chest" is the tradition's phrase for releasing a sensation of tightness, oppression or fullness across the ribs, and our own indication record carries asthma at this point for that reason. A point on the back reaching the front of the body is exactly what this action describes.
- Benefits the breasts — the third recorded action, and the most distinctive. Our own use record carries insufficient lactation and breast abscess here, and the classical and modern literature both preserve the association. It is one of the few points on the back of the body with a documented breast indication, and the reason is the same as for the chest action: the point lies on the far side of the same segment of chest wall.
- Relaxes the sinews of the shoulder region — an extension of the first action rather than a separate one. The reference literature records SI-11 for contracture, stiffness and restricted movement of the shoulder joint, and it is the point most often reached for when the muscle of the scapular hollow is itself tight and sore.
Why SI-11 carries no point category — and why that does not diminish it. Queried directly, this point holds no five-shu, yuan, luo, xi-cleft, back-shu, front-mu or confluent classification and no element, and none is recorded for it in the standard references either. That is worth stating plainly because the Small Intestine channel is unusually rich in categories at its far end — SI-01 Shao Ze is the Jing-Well and Metal point, SI-02 Qian Gu the Ying-Spring and Water point, SI-03 Hou Xi the Shu-Stream and Wood point and the Confluent point of the Governing Vessel, SI-04 Wan Gu the Yuan-Source point, SI-05 Yang Gu the Jing-River and Fire point, SI-06 Yang Lao the Cleft point, SI-07 Zhi Zheng the Connecting point and SI-08 Xiao Hai the He-Sea and Earth point, all held here and all queried. SI-11 has none of them, and it is nonetheless the most used point on the channel above the elbow. A point does not need a classification to matter; position can be the whole argument, and here it is.

What is SI-11 Tian Zong used for?
Tian Zong SI-11 is used above all for pain and stiffness of the shoulder blade and shoulder, for pain running down the back and outer side of the arm to the elbow, and — the indication readers least expect — for disorders of the breast, including insufficient lactation and breast abscess. The indications below are those carried in Sacred Lotus sources & references together with those set out in the standard reference literature. They describe traditional use, not proven treatment. This is a comparatively low-hazard point, for the reasons set out under needling.
- Pain in the scapular region — the defining indication
- Stiffness, aching and heaviness of the shoulder blade
- Pain in the shoulder joint and difficulty raising the arm
- Pain on the back and outer aspect of the elbow and upper arm
- Pain referred from the shoulder blade down the arm
- Contracture and restricted movement of the shoulder
- Pain and stiffness of the neck extending to the shoulder blade
- Asthma, wheezing and difficult breathing
- Fullness and oppression of the chest
- Pain in the flanks and between the ribs
- Insufficient lactation — too little milk after childbirth
- Breast abscess and mastitis
- Breast distension, swelling and pain
- Cough
The breast indications are not an oddity, and they are worth explaining. Sacred Lotus sources & references carry "promotes lactation" and "breast abscesses" in this point's own use record, and its recorded action is to benefit the breasts. The classical rationale is positional: SI-11 sits on the back of the same segment of chest wall the breast sits on at the front, and the tradition treats front and back of a segment as reachable from either side. The points that carry the breast most directly from the front are held here too — Ru Gen ST-18 at the base of the breast, the principal classical breast point; Shan Zhong REN-17 on the breastbone, the Hui-Meeting Point of the Qi and the Front Mu point of the Pericardium; and Shao Ze SI-01 at the little fingertip, the Small Intestine channel's own Jing-Well point, whose recorded action is to promote lactation and benefit the breasts. SI-11 belongs with them, and shares a channel with SI-01.

Where is SI-11 Tian Zong, and how is it used in practice?
Tian Zong lies in the middle of the hollow on the back of the shoulder blade, below the bony ridge that runs across it, roughly level with the fourth thoracic vertebra. In our own words: run a finger along the hard ridge that crosses the upper part of the shoulder blade, drop just below its midpoint into the broad shallow hollow beneath, and move about a third of the way down toward the bottom corner of the blade. The spot is usually tender, often markedly so, and there is bone directly beneath the finger the whole time. Sacred Lotus sources & references hold two location records for it, one measuring from the ridge of the scapula and the bottom corner of the blade, the other giving the vertebral level.
One wording difference between our two location records is worth flagging rather than smoothing over. The Chinese Acupuncture & Moxibustion rendering held here describes the point as lying in the depression at the centre of the "subscapular fossa". In strict anatomical usage the subscapular fossa is on the front of the shoulder blade, against the ribs, and cannot be reached from the back at all; the hollow the point actually occupies is the infraspinous fossa on the dorsal surface, below the spine of the scapula. Our Deadman & Al-Khafaji record describes exactly that dorsal hollow and leaves no ambiguity. Both of our location records are kept unchanged; the note is added because the phrase recurs across the English-language literature and readers meet it constantly.
Which points is SI-11 combined with?
- With Jian Zhen SI-09, Nao Shu SI-10, Bing Feng SI-12 and Qu Yuan SI-13 — its immediate neighbours on the same channel around the shoulder blade, all held here. SI-10 is a Meeting Point of the Small Intestine and Bladder channels with the Yang Linking and Yang Motility Vessels, and SI-12 a Meeting Point of the Small Intestine, Large Intestine, Sanjiao and Gallbladder channels — both queried. Needling two or three of this run together is the ordinary local treatment for the scapular region.
- With Jian Yu LI-15 and Jian Liao SJ-14 — the two points on the top and outer side of the shoulder. The trio SI-11, LI-15 and SJ-14 is the commonest published shoulder combination in the modern literature, appearing in trial after trial for frozen shoulder, rotator cuff pain and post-stroke shoulder pain. It also appears with Jian Zhen SI-09 as a set of four (PMID 28619769).
- With Jian Jing GB-21 — on the top of the shoulder, a Meeting Point of the Gallbladder, Sanjiao and Stomach channels with the Yang Linking Vessel, queried here. The GB-21 and SI-11 pairing covers the top and the back of the shoulder girdle between them. GB-21 carries a documented pneumothorax hazard that SI-11 does not, which is set out under needling.
- With Hou Xi SI-03 — the same channel's Shu-Stream and Wood point at the hand, and the Confluent point of the Governing Vessel, held here. Pairing a local point on the scapula with a distal point on the same channel at the hand is the standard distal-and-local structure, and SI-03 is the Small Intestine channel's usual distal choice for the neck, shoulder and upper back.
- For the breast — with Ru Gen ST-18 and Shan Zhong REN-17, the two principal front-of-chest breast points held here, and with Shao Ze SI-01 at the little fingertip for insufficient lactation. A network analysis of 312 published studies covering 343 acupoint prescriptions for breast hyperplasia identified Tianzong SI-11 among the sixteen core acupoints, alongside REN-17, LIV-14, SP-06, LIV-03, ST-36, GB-21, ST-18, ST-15, P-06, ST-40, REN-04, KI-03, BL-18 and Ashi points (Zhen Ci Yan Jiu 2021;46(1):76–83, PMID 33559431). Every one of those is held in this library.
- With the cervical Jiaji points and Feng Chi GB-20 — where the scapular pain is referred from the neck rather than arising in the shoulder itself, which the modern literature treats as the commoner case.
Why is SI-11 the point practitioners reach for most on the shoulder blade?
Because it is the only widely used point in the middle of the infraspinous hollow, and because that hollow is where scapular pain concentrates. The blade is a large, flat, thinly covered bone, and the muscle filling the hollow below its ridge is one of the most reliably tender muscles in the body in anyone with shoulder trouble. SI-11 sits over the thick belly of that muscle. Two independent lines of evidence converge on the same spot, and both are worth stating precisely because neither is quite about the acupoint:
- Pressure pain thresholds measured at SI-11 by name. A cross-sectional matched case-control study in Beijing measured pressure pain thresholds at four acupoints — Tianzong SI-11, Jianliao SJ-14, Jianyu LI-15 and Jianzhen SI-09 — in 30 patients with one-sided shoulder pain and 30 healthy controls. Thresholds were significantly lower on the painful side than the unpainful side, and lower on patients' unpainful side than in controls, while non-acupoint sites showed no such difference (BMJ Open 2017;7(6):e014438, PMID 28619769, PMC5541597). The honest part of that result is the part usually left out: the correlation with the study's peripheral and central sensitisation indices was found at SJ-14, LI-15 and SI-09 — and not at SI-11. The study measured this point and reported a weaker association for it than for its three neighbours.
- The muscle beneath has been mapped — but the study did not name the acupoint. A topographical mapping study divided the area over the infraspinatus into ten one-square-centimetre sub-areas in 19 patients with one-sided shoulder and arm pain, measured the pressure pain threshold in each, and then needled each sub-area to provoke a twitch or referred pain. Thresholds were lowest on the painful side and lowest of all at the midfibre region of the muscle, where multiple active trigger points clustered (Ge HY et al., Eur J Pain 2008;12(7):859–65, PMID 18203637). That study is about the infraspinatus muscle and does not mention SI-11 or any acupoint. It is cited because the midfibre region it identifies is the part of the hollow SI-11 occupies — an anatomical coincidence worth knowing, not a finding about the point.

Where is SI-11 located?
- A Manual of Acupuncture (p. 241): On the scapula, in a tender depression one third of the distance from the midpoint of the inferior border of the scapular spine to the inferior angle of the scapula.
- Chinese Acupuncture and Moxibustion (p. 171): On the scapula, in the depression of the center of the subscapular fossa, and at the level of the 4th thoracic vertebra.
How is SI-11 Tian Zong needled, and is it a dangerous point?
Stated plainly: SI-11 is a comparatively low-hazard point, and the reason is a single anatomical fact — the flat body of the shoulder blade lies directly beneath it. A needle at this point meets skin, fat, the muscle filling the infraspinous hollow, and then bone. There is no body cavity, no lung and no great vessel in the path, and the depth our records carry — perpendicular or oblique, 0.5 to 1.0 inch — is an ordinary soft-tissue depth over a bony floor rather than a bounded safety figure. That deserves saying directly rather than attaching a generic caution, because SI-11 sits within a few centimetres of points where the hazard is real and documented, and the difference between them is the scapula. Everything below is recorded as neutral reference data describing what the textbooks and the published literature state. It is not instruction, this page does not teach technique, and needling is carried out only by a qualified, licensed practitioner.
The angle and depth the texts record
- Sacred Lotus sources & references record perpendicular or oblique insertion of 0.5 to 1.0 inch, with moxibustion applicable. No caution accompanies it in our record — which is itself informative, given how many points in this library carry one.
- Deadman & Al-Khafaji (p. 241) and Chinese Acupuncture & Moxibustion (p. 171) record a comparable perpendicular or oblique range over the infraspinous fossa. Neither attaches the pneumothorax caution that both attach to the thoracic Back-Shu points, to the lateral chest points and to the points above the collarbone.
- For comparison within our own holdings. Queried directly, our records give 0.3 to 0.5 inch oblique at Da Bao SP-21 on the lateral chest wall and at the Spleen points above it, and 0.5 to 0.7 inch at the thoracic Back-Shu points such as Fei Shu BL-13 — all tighter figures than SI-11's, at points where the lung lies beneath. Depth figures in this literature track the structure underneath, not the size of the region, and SI-11's comparatively generous figure is a statement about the bone behind it.
- Moxibustion, cupping and massage are all recorded here and are common at this point. A 1982 clinical report of 47 cases of acute mastitis used moxibustion at Tanzhong REN-17 combined with massage — not needling — at Tianzong (J Tradit Chin Med 1982;2(2):109–10, PMID 6765696), and the flat bony floor is a large part of why manual and heat techniques suit this location so well.
- Needling technique at this point has itself been written about. A paper devoted to needling manipulation at Tianzong appeared in the English-language Chinese literature (Chen Y, Zheng K, J Tradit Chin Med 2002;22(1):38–41, PMID 11977520). We record its existence; no abstract is indexed, and no technique from it is reproduced here.
What actually lies beneath
- The scapula. The infraspinous fossa is a broad, shallow, gently curved plate of bone. The point lies over its middle, where the bone is continuous and the muscle covering it is at its thickest. A needle inserted perpendicularly at this point is travelling toward bone, not toward a cavity.
- The muscle and its nerve. The infraspinatus fills the hollow and is supplied by the suprascapular nerve, which reaches it around the outer edge of the scapular spine — lateral and superior to the point rather than under it. The suprascapular artery accompanies it on the same course.
- Where the bone stops — and why it matters. The scapula does not protect the whole shoulder region. Below the bottom corner of the blade, medial to its inner border, and above the level of the collarbone, the chest wall is exposed and the lung lies close. That is precisely where the documented hazards of this region are: our own records for the thoracic Back-Shu run, for the lateral chest points and for Jian Jing GB-21 on the top of the shoulder all carry the pneumothorax caution, and GB-21 has a measured figure attached to it in the published literature. SI-11 is not in that group. The useful way to hold the anatomy is that the shoulder blade is an island of safety on a chest wall that is otherwise thin.
- No imaging study measuring a safe needling depth at SI-11 could be located, and none is needed in the way it is over the ribs: the depth is bounded by bone rather than by a membrane. It is worth noting that a paediatric chest CT study which measured skin-to-pleura distances at 23 individually named points, including SI-14 and SI-15 on the upper back, did not measure SI-11 — the Small Intestine points it covers are the two above the scapular spine, not this one.
- Two general facts about depth. Two systematic reviews of the safe-depth literature — 33 studies in the first, 47 in the second, by MRI, CT, ultrasound and cadaveric dissection — both concluded that measured depths for the same point vary greatly between subject groups and measuring methods, and that "safe depth" has never been standardised (J Altern Complement Med 2011;17(3):199–206, PMID 21417806; Evid Based Complement Alternat Med 2013;2013:740508, PMID 23935678). Neither reports a figure for this point.
What is documented, and one unexpected effect worth recording
- The ordinary events are minor. Bruising, brief local soreness and a lingering ache in the muscle are what the reference literature records at points of this kind. A meta-analysis of prospective clinical studies found that about half of all recorded acupuncture adverse events across the whole repertoire were bleeding, pain or flare at the needle site (Bäumler P et al., BMJ Open 2021;11:e045961, PMID 34489268).
- A published case of unexpected lactation, and it names this point. A 41-year-old woman with breast cancer, treated with acupuncture for pain after mastectomy and reconstruction using paravertebral segmental points, trigger points and a contralateral hand point, developed an episode of galactorrhoea — milk production in the unaffected breast — six days after her first treatment and again during her second, having not lactated for four years. Brain imaging showed no abnormality. The authors noted that the traditional Chinese literature uses "the Tianzong acupoint SI11" to promote lactation, and that in this patient the point coincided with a trigger point over the infraspinatus that had been included in the treatment; they linked the effect to reported rises in prolactin and oxytocin after acupuncture (Jenner C, Filshie J, Acupunct Med 2002;20(2-3):107–8, PMID 12216598). This is a single case report and proves nothing about mechanism. It is recorded because it is one of the very few published observations that touches this point by name, and because it corroborates our own use record — which carries "promotes lactation" at SI-11 — from an entirely unexpected direction, in a setting where the effect was not wanted.
- Honest limit. We could not source any published case report of injury at SI-11, and none is asserted. Where a point is low-hazard, the useful thing is to say so plainly rather than import a warning from a neighbouring region, and that is what is done here.
Risk in proportion
A meta-analysis of prospective clinical studies estimated serious adverse events in acupuncture at approximately 1 per 10,000 patients and around 8 per million treatments, placing it among the safer treatments in medicine (PMID 34489268). Systematic reviews of the Chinese case literature agree about where those events cluster: over the chest, the abdomen, the neck and the orbit, attributed chiefly to improper technique (He W et al., PMID 22967282; Zhang J et al., Bull World Health Organ 2010;88(12):915–921C, PMID 21124716, PMC2995190). SI-11 is not in that group, and the accurate summary is that it is one of the straightforward points of the upper back.

What does the name Tian Zong mean?
Tian Zong means "Celestial Gathering" — tian, heaven or the celestial, and zong, an ancestral gathering or clan assembly. Sacred Lotus sources & references translate it exactly that way; it is also met as "Heavenly Gathering" and "Ancestral Assembly". Both halves of the name are doing work. Tian marks the upper part of the body: the classical naming convention gives tian to points of the chest, shoulders, neck and head, and the Small Intestine channel carries three of them in a row as it climbs — Tian Zong SI-11 on the shoulder blade, Tian Chuang SI-16 ("Celestial Window") and Tian Rong SI-17 ("Celestial Countenance") on the neck, all held here. Zong is the gathering. The shoulder blade is where the channel spreads across the widest surface it will ever cross, and where several channels converge in the neighbourhood — an assembly point, in the name's own image.
Is Tian Zong SI-11 or ST-11?
It is SI-11 — the eleventh point of the Small Intestine Channel of Hand Tai Yang — and this is worth stating outright because at least one indexed publication prints it wrongly. A clinical study of digital acupoint pressure for nerve-root cervical spondylosis in 400 patients lists its treatment points as "Quepen (ST 12), Jianjing (GB 21) and Tianzong (ST 11)" (Zhongguo Zhen Jiu 2009;29(8):659–62, PMID 19947274). ST-11 is Qi She ("Qi Abode") on the Stomach channel, held here and queried: it lies at the base of the neck, at the upper border of the inner end of the collarbone. It is not Tianzong, it is not on the shoulder blade, and it sits in the band above the collarbone where needling carries a documented pneumothorax hazard that the scapular point does not. The miscoding is named here rather than passed over because point codes are how this literature is searched and cross-referenced, and a wrong code sends a reader to the wrong anatomy. Every other study cited on this page was read rather than counted, and each prints SI 11 correctly.
How is SI-11 different from the points around it?
Jian Zhen SI-09 lies below and behind the armpit, at the bottom of the same channel's shoulder run. Nao Shu SI-10 lies above it, and is a Meeting Point of the Small Intestine and Bladder channels with the Yang Linking and Yang Motility Vessels — queried here. Bing Feng SI-12, above the scapular spine, is a Meeting Point of the Small Intestine, Large Intestine, Sanjiao and Gallbladder channels; Qu Yuan SI-13 sits at the inner end of the spine of the scapula. Jian Wai Shu SI-14 and Jian Zhong Shu SI-15 continue medially onto the upper back beside the vertebrae — and there the scapula no longer lies beneath, which is why the safety picture changes at those two and not at this one. All are held in this library, and all were queried. Among them SI-11 is the only one in the middle of the infraspinous hollow, and it is the one that carries the breast and chest actions.
Is there research on SI-11 Tian Zong?
Yes — and unusually for a point of the upper back, some of it is genuinely point-specific rather than protocol-wide. It is a small literature and a mixed one, and both halves are set out here.
- A randomised trial in which SI-11 was the variable. Sixty-two patients with obstinate tennis elbow were randomised to triple puncture at Tianzong SI-11 combined with local elbow points, or to the local elbow points alone. The cure rate was reported as 71.9 per cent in the Tianzong group against 43.3 per cent in the control group (Zhongguo Zhen Jiu 2007;27(2):109–11, PMID 17370492). This is the closest thing in the indexed literature to a test of what adding this point does, and it is notable that the target was the elbow rather than the shoulder — consistent with our own indication record, which carries pain of the lateroposterior elbow and arm at this point. The cautions belong with it: it is a single small study, the outcome is a categorical "cure rate" of limited reliability, and no sham control was used.
- Pressure pain thresholds measured at SI-11 by name — with a partly negative result. The Beijing matched case-control study described under how the point is used measured thresholds at SI-11, SJ-14, LI-15 and SI-09 in shoulder-pain patients and controls (PMID 28619769, PMC5541597). Thresholds at all four were lower on the painful side, but the association with the study's sensitisation indices was found at SJ-14, LI-15 and SI-09 and not at SI-11. The paper is cited here in full rather than for its favourable half.
- SI-11 as a core point in the breast literature. A complex-network analysis of 312 articles, 343 acupoint prescriptions and 113 acupoints used for breast hyperplasia identified Tianzong SI-11 among the sixteen core acupoints (PMID 33559431). That is a finding about prescribing practice, not about effect, and it is reported as such.
- The older breast literature. A 1982 report of 47 cases of acute mastitis treated with moxibustion at REN-17 and massage at Tianzong (PMID 6765696) is the earliest indexed item naming this point. It is an uncontrolled case series from a period with no trial standards, and it is recorded as a historical marker rather than as evidence.
- A paper on needling manipulation at Tianzong (PMID 11977520) exists in the indexed record without an abstract; its existence is noted and nothing is claimed from it.
- What is not here. There is no sham-controlled trial of SI-11, and no study in which it is isolated against a credible control for shoulder pain — the condition it is most used for. In the shoulder-pain trials it appears as one point among four or five, most often with LI-15, SJ-14 and SI-09, and nothing in those results is attributable to it alone. The infraspinatus dry-needling literature — including a randomised trial of exercise with and without trigger-point dry needling in subacromial pain syndrome (J Pain 2017;18(1):11–18, PMID 27720812) and a controlled study of segmental effects from needling shoulder trigger points (J Rehabil Med 2010;42(5):463–8, PMID 20544158) — concerns the muscle and does not name this or any acupoint. Those studies are cited to describe the surrounding evidence honestly, not to borrow their conclusions for SI-11.
